Sunrise was a German pop group that was popular in the late 1970s .

Band history

In 1978 the group achieved success in the German single charts with the title song of their debut album Call on Me . The song was written by the two band members Holger Julian Copp and Hanno Harders, who worked together as Beagle Music Ltd. in the mid-1980s . had another hit. Other band members were Jörg Fries and Michael Reinecke , who produced the song and later also made a name for himself as a music producer.

A German version of the song was created in the same year with the title Wir zieh'n heute 'Abend auf Dach , with which Jürgen Drews also entered the charts. This in turn was parodied by Fips Asmussen , who turned it into the title I'll get one on the roof tonight .

In the 2000s the song was rediscovered and released again in German by a group called Two 4 Good together with Drews. There is also a recording of the original version of ATC from 2002.

After the quartet had no further success with the second album Paradise , Sunrise broke up again.
